What the Data Says About Daveion
The Social Security Administration has registered 634 babies named Daveion between 1986 and 2024, spanning 39 consecutive years of U.S. birth records. As a boy's name, Daveion currently holds the #12787 rank among boys for 2024. The name reached its historical peak in 2008, when 42 babies received it in a single year.
Decade-level aggregation shows that Daveion performed strongest in the 2000s, accumulating 334 births during that ten-year window. Across the 5 decades of recorded activity, Daveion shows a clear decline from its mid-century high. Geographically, the name is most concentrated in Texas, which accounts for 28 births — the largest state-level total in the dataset — followed by Illinois and Michigan. In total, SSA state-level files list Daveion in 6 of the 51 U.S. reporting jurisdictions.
No etymological entry is currently available for Daveion in our reference dataset. These figures derive from SSA's annual national and state-level name files, which include any name appearing at least five times in a given year or state-year; names below that threshold are suppressed for privacy and therefore excluded from the totals shown here. The 634 total represents a lower bound — actual usage may be higher in years or states where the count fell below the disclosure floor.
